▸ adjective: (anatomy, relational, often with to) Closer to the surface of the body; especially, situated or occurring on the skin or immediately beneath it.
▸ adjective: Appearing to be true or real only until examined more closely.
▸ adjective: Not thorough, deep, or complete; concerned only with the obvious or apparent.
▸ adjective: Lacking depth of character or understanding; lacking substance or significance.
▸ adjective: (rare) Two-dimensional; drawn on a flat surface.
▸ adjective: (British, architecture) Denoting a quantity of a material expressed in terms of area covered rather than linear dimension or volume.
▸ noun: (usually in the plural) A surface detail.
